Is there a way we can combine more than one dimension into one list box. I have a situation wherein I have budgets for next 10 years as columns. Can I have all these 10 years combined into one list box for selection.
Particulars 2011 2012 2013 2014 2015 and so on
Sales
Direct Cost
Indirect Cost
Please let me know if you have encountered similar requirement.

I get the confusion. If I understand it correctly he want the fieldnames in a list.
Years is in his case not a field, but the header of a colum in Excel.
With the below Inline you could make the wanted list, but how do you connenct them to the fieldnames?
Years:
Load * Inline [
Year
2010
2011
2012
2013
2014
2015
];
